> >+static const char *io_port_to_string(uint32_t io_port)
> >+{
> >+ if (io_port>= QXL_IO_RANGE_SIZE) {
> >+ return "out of range";
> >+ }
> >+ switch (io_port) {
> >+ case QXL_IO_NOTIFY_CMD:
> >+ return "QXL_IO_NOTIFY_CMD";
> >+ case QXL_IO_NOTIFY_CURSOR:
> >+ return "QXL_IO_NOTIFY_CURSOR";
>
> That becomes alot more readable when using a c99 array for it:
>
> static const char *io_port_names[QXL_IO_RANGE_SIZE] = {
> [ QXL_IO_NOTIFY_CMD ] = "notify-cmd",
> [ QXL_IO_NOTIFY_CURSOR ] = "notify-cursor",
> [ ... ]
> };
